Hi,
With the OpenCA 9.1.7 when I ask for an IE Certificate and I have an installed chipcard,
a message VBscript automatically appears "Yuo are using patched Internet Explorer",
then I click on OK and I can choose different Cryptographic device as
GemPlus
eToken
......... etc.
With OpenCA 9.2 in the menu "Cryptographic device" it appears only "Default."
Besides I don't succeed signing request certificate with the RA Operator Key.
I have the impression that OpenCA doesn't communicate with IE.
Can you help me?

This problem was solved at 2004-Feb-18. So the newest snapshots should communicate with IE. There were some problems in OpenCA::UI::HTML (HTML.pm).
